#a2faca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a2faca is composed of 63.5% red, 98%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 147.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 80.8%. #a2faca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#45f595.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#a2faca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a2faca has RGB values of R:162, G:250,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10681034.

Hex triplet a2faca #a2faca
RGB Decimal 162, 250, 202 rgb(162,250,202)
RGB Percent 63.5, 98, 79.2 rgb(63.5%,98%,79.2%)
CMYK 35, 0, 19, 2
HSL 147.3°, 89.8, 80.8 hsl(147.3,89.8%,80.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 147.3°, 35.2, 98
Web Safe 99ffcc #99ffcc
CIE-LAB 91.826, -36.46, 14.761
XYZ 59.743, 80.314, 68.228
xyY 0.287, 0.386, 80.314
CIE-LCH 91.826, 39.335, 157.959
CIE-LUV 91.826, -41.993, 28.257
Hunter-Lab 89.618, -37.836, 17.594
Binary 10100010, 11111010, 11001010

Shades and Tints of #a2faca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a2faca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bd1ce is the less saturated color, while #9efeca is the most saturated one.
